Hartz Groomer’s Best De-Shedder Cat Brush Description

  • Contains 1 Hartz Groomer’s Best Fur Fetcher for Cats.
  • REMOVES 3X MORE FUR: Cat deshedding brush with a patented design that removes three times more fur than just brushing alone.
  • HOW IT WORKS: The fine, dense deshedding combs remove large amounts of dead, loose undercoat without disturbing your cat’s delicate skin or topcoat to dramatically reduce future shedding.
  • NO METAL BLADES: Design utilizes highly effective microcombs without the use of harsh metal blades to make your cat’s deshedding and grooming session more enjoyable.
  • SPECIAL DESIGN: The innovative brush design coupled with the ergonomically designed handle allows for maximum comfort and control for cats of all ages and coat types.
